This patch redirects the output of gcj --version so it doesn't
intrude on configure's output. It also ensures a 'no' response appears
when the test fails.
2010-05-04 Andrew John Hughes <[email protected]>
* m4/ac_prog_javac.m4:
Capture all output from javac --version
to avoid excess output. Make sure no appears
when javac is not gcj.

Index: m4/ac_prog_javac.m4
===================================================================
RCS file: /sources/classpath/classpath/m4/ac_prog_javac.m4,v
retrieving revision 1.6
diff -u -u -r1.6 ac_prog_javac.m4
--- m4/ac_prog_javac.m4 13 Sep 2008 03:07:27 -0000 1.6
+++ m4/ac_prog_javac.m4 4 May 2010 17:29:10 -0000
@@ -46,10 +46,13 @@
fi
test "x$JAVAC" = x && AC_MSG_ERROR([no acceptable Java compiler found in
\$PATH])
AC_CACHE_CHECK([if $JAVAC is a version of gcj], ac_cv_prog_javac_is_gcj, [
-if $JAVAC --version | grep gcj > /dev/null; then
+if $JAVAC --version 2>&1 | grep gcj >&AS_MESSAGE_LOG_FD ; then
ac_cv_prog_javac_is_gcj=yes;
JAVAC="$JAVAC $GCJ_OPTS";
-fi])
+else
+ ac_cv_prog_javac_is_gcj=no;
+fi
+])
AC_SUBST(JAVAC_IS_GCJ, $ac_cv_prog_javac_is_gcj)
AM_CONDITIONAL(GCJ_JAVAC, test x"${JAVAC_IS_GCJ}" = xyes)
AC_PROG_JAVAC_WORKS
